Four-year-old Emily Molner's father, who is being held in St. Petersburg after authorities in Russia prevented her from leaving the country, announced Friday (Friday) that she was granted a permit to return to Israel this Monday. The father also added that Emily's mother traveled to Russia with the hope that they would return to Israel together.

Mulner, an Israeli girl on the autistic continuum, stayed with her grandmother in Russia to receive special sensitive treatments. However, after passing the time allowed by her visa, the Russian authorities demanded a financial penalty to allow her to leave the country. His father, Yigal Mullner, spoke with Walla! NEWS earlier this week that "as soon as they arrived at St. Petersburg airport, they were delayed on the grounds that the grandmother could leave, but the girl was staying illegally. The laws worked upside down. Her visa expired after three months, and she stayed there for six months."

Since then, Mulner was staying with her grandmother. The Foreign Ministry, which is working to restore Molner, explained at the time that the family must settle the matter with the immigration authorities, including the financial fine, in order for the Russian authorities to allow the child to leave. The father said on Sunday that "our message is that they will not make political fortune from my child. I sincerely hope that is not the case."

The Foreign Ministry reported a week ago that the two were not detained or arrested and are not in danger. "For reasons that seem to be in violation of local immigration laws, the grandmother must settle the matter in front of the immigration offices on the return this weekend, on Monday. The Israeli Consulate General in St. Petersburg will continue to monitor and assist the family as needed."
